APPLICATIONS |
||
| Sunset Yellow FCF is a synthetic acid dye containing both NN and CC chromophore groups (pyrazolone dye). It is an orange to red powder or granules; soluble in water; decomposes at melting point 360 C; used in coloring food, cosmetics and meications (FD & C Yellow No.6). It is an anionic dye applied to natural and synthetic fibers, leather, and paper. The chemical designation is 6-hydroxy-5-[(4-sulfophenyl)azo]-2- Naphthalene sulfonic acid, disodium salt. Acid dyes are water-soluble dyes employed mostly in the form of sodium salts of the sulfonic or carboxylic acids. They are anionic which attach strongly to cationic groups in the fibre directly. They can be applicable to all kind of natural fibres like wool, cotton and silk as well as to synthetics like polyesters, acrylic and rayon. But they are not substantive to cellulosic fibres. They are also used in paints, inks, plastics and leather. | ||
